In 1586, Samuel Appleton entered the world in Little Waldingfield, Babergh District, Suffolk, England, born to Thomas Appleton And Mary Isaack. Samuel Appleton married Judith Mary Everard, and had children including Hannah Appleton. Samuel Appleton passed away in 1670 in Rowley, Essex County, Massachusetts, United States of America.
